Marula Biscotti
Ingredients
- 1 cup plain flour
- 1 cup brown wheat toasted meal
- Rind of 1 lemon
- ½ teaspoon baking powder
- 1 cup brown sugar
- 4 tablespoons soft stork margarine
- 2 eggs lightly beaten
- 30 ml milk
- 1 teaspoon vanilla essence
- 200g chopped marula nuts
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 175 degrees C.
- Roast nuts until golden (15 min). Remove the skins as much as possible.
- Mix all dry ingredients, rub in butter and nuts then add the milk mixed with vanilla essence and eggs. Mix well. Use hands.
- With floured hands, get dough together. Divide into 3 (20cm) long fat sausages, place in greased tray and bake for about 30 min. Turn half way to brown on both sides.
- Slice carefully (1cm thick slices) and finish drying in the oven (70 degrees C, slightly open oven, for as much as 2 hours).

Would love to make this recipe but what is brown wheat toasted meal?
Where can I get it in Zimbabwe?
Thankyou
It can be bought in every supermarket, from the traditional foods section (with the special flours/meals, porridges, and dried veg and local herbal teas also often). Utsanzi and/or Four Seasons brand.
Just using 2 cups plain flour will also work of course.
